Abstract

Vertical farming is one of the important solutions to overcome future food and population problems. However, underdeveloped countries can't afford due to high initial investment costs and technical huddles. To solve this problem, it is necessary to formalize the vertical farming area using ontology. In this paper, we present an ontology that includes various cultivation methods of vertical farming, connects sensors and actuates according to the methods, and recognizes and controls the cultivation environment context of the selected vertical farming. we expect to be able to autonomously make control decisions about the context by analyzing the environmental context that is important for perceived vertical cultivation using the logical reasoning function of ontology.
